Chapter 1: Demystifying SEO

SEO, short for Search Engine Optimization, is the process of enhancing your website’s visibility on search engines like Google, Bing, and Yahoo. Here’s what you need to know:

1.1 What is SEO?

At its core, SEO is about improving your website’s ranking on search engine results pages. When someone searches for a specific keyword or phrase, SEO ensures that your website appears closer to the top of the list.

1.2 Why is SEO Important?

Effective SEO drives organic traffic to your website, increases brand visibility, and ultimately boosts conversions. It’s like having a prime spot on a busy street – more people are likely to notice and engage with your content.

Chapter 2: Keyword Research and Analysis

Keywords are the foundation of SEO. They are the words or phrases that users type into search engines. Let’s explore how to conduct effective keyword research:

2.1 Choosing the Right Keywords

Start by selecting keywords that are relevant to your content. Tools like Google Keyword Planner can help you identify high-potential keywords.

2.2 Long-Tail Keywords

Don’t overlook long-tail keywords – they may have lower search volume but often bring in more targeted traffic.

2.3 Analyzing Keyword Competition

Assess the competition for your chosen keywords. High competition may require more effort to rank.

Chapter 3: On-Page SEO

On-page SEO refers to optimizing individual web pages to rank higher and earn more relevant traffic. Let’s explore the key elements:

3.1 Title Tags

The title tag is like the headline of your web page. It should be concise, descriptive, and contain your primary keyword.

3.2 Meta Descriptions

Meta descriptions provide a brief summary of your content. Craft compelling descriptions that entice users to click on your link.

3.3 Header Tags (H1, H2, H3)

Header tags structure your content. Use them to break up text and include keywords where relevant.

Chapter 4: Content is King

High-quality content is the heart of SEO. Here’s how to create content that not only ranks but also engages your audience:

4.1 Valuable, Informative Content

Provide information that your target audience finds valuable. This establishes your authority in your niche.

4.2 Content-Length Matters

Long-form content tends to rank higher. Aim for comprehensive, in-depth articles when appropriate.

4.3 Internal Linking

Link to other relevant pages on your website. This not only aids navigation but also helps search engines understand your content’s structure.

Chapter 5: Off-Page SEO

Off-page SEO focuses on factors outside your website that influence your rankings. Here’s what you need to know:

5.1 Backlinks

High-quality backlinks from authoritative websites can significantly boost your SEO efforts. Focus on earning backlinks naturally.

5.2 Social Signals

Engagement on social media can indirectly impact your SEO. Share your content to increase visibility and potentially earn more backlinks.

Chapter 6: Technical SEO

Technical SEO involves optimizing your website’s technical aspects for search engines. It ensures that search engine crawlers can access and index your site effectively:

6.1 Site Speed

A fast-loading website improves user experience and can positively impact rankings.

6.2 Mobile-Friendliness

With the rise of mobile users, having a mobile-responsive website is crucial for SEO success.

6.3 Site Structure

A well-structured website with a clear hierarchy makes it easier for search engines to understand your content.

Chapter 7: Monitoring and Analytics

To gauge the effectiveness of your SEO efforts, you need to monitor your website’s performance:

7.1 Google Analytics

Use Google Analytics to track website traffic, user behavior, and conversions.

7.2 Search Console

Google Search Console provides insights into how Google sees your website, including crawl errors and indexing issues.

Chapter 8: Staying Updated

SEO is constantly evolving. Keep up with the latest trends and algorithm updates:

8.1 Algorithm Changes

Search engines frequently update their algorithms. Stay informed to adapt your strategy.

8.2 Industry Trends

Follow industry blogs and attend conferences to stay ahead of the curve.
